Loading... 小程序中的时间数据在安卓上能正常显示,但在ios系统上会显示NaN 原因是ios不支持在数据库中传递 2018-08-08这种格式的日期,必须转换为2018/08/08这种格式才会显示正常; 小程序代码示例: ```js var data= '2019-08-08 16:16:16' //使用replace函数,调用data.replace(/\-/g, "/")将全部的"-"替换为"/" var datatime= data.replace(/\-/g, "/") //获取秒数,可自行切换为.getDate()获取天数或.getMonth() + 1获取月份等其他Date操作 var newdata = new Date(datatime).getTime() ``` 或 ```js var data = '2018-08-08 16:16:16' var format = data.replace(/-/g, '/') var timestamp = Date.parse(new Date(format)) ``` 最后修改:2021 年 12 月 24 日 © 允许规范转载 打赏 赞赏作者 微信 赞 0 如果觉得我的文章对你有用,请随意赞赏